The Emergence of Professionalized Esports Education
Much like traditional sports, esports demands specialized skills, strategic thinking, and a high degree of technical proficiency. Recognizing this, educational initiatives have evolved to offer targeted training programs. These programs go beyond casual play, cultivating expert skills through rigorous coaching and structured curricula.
Institutions such as Esports High Schools and dedicated online platforms now implement data-driven training regimes, including biomechanics of mouse control, strategic map analysis, and team coordination techniques. Industry reports indicate that players engaged in formal training are up to 35% more likely to succeed in competitive tournaments, highlighting the importance of structured education.
Monitoring and Enhancing Performance with Data Analytics
One of the critical innovations in esports training is the integration of sophisticated data analytics tools. These platforms track in-game metrics—such as reaction times, accuracy, positioning, and decision-making patterns—to craft personalized improvement plans.
